Tucker is a friendly and energetic 4-year-old neutered Shar Pei/Boxer mix who weighs 63 pounds.
He came to PAWS from the Clinton County SPCA.
He’s a loving boy who is good with children and some other dogs, but he’s not very good with cats.
Tucker is house broken and is extremely smart. He already know the commands for “sit,” “stay,” “down,” and “paw!”
